Meeting outlineReview activities and progress of MICE Schedule Magnet reports (AFC, SS, CC)

Magnetic field (external to “MICE channel”) Operations

(MOM, target, DAQ, controls and monitoring) Results from April-May run Publications (Beam line paper - out) Understanding of the physics of the experiment (Analysis session) Software development

Planning for Step IV Where are we?

Magnets, EMR, LH2,Solid absorbers Stray B field issues February 2013 start Step IV?

Planning for MICE Step VI RFCC modules, RF power

On the n front

Quite interesting since our last CM No Virginia, ns do not travel faster than

the speed of light (well, maybe in Italy) But, yes, q13 is large

& we already know its value to excellent precision

The NF is simpler, cheaper, & still blows away the competition

But it is still much more expensive than the competition

Plus in Kyoto MiniBooNE showed new results on ne/ne-

bar appearance. No longer diff between n and n-bar &

significance > 3 (s 3.8 in combined fit) Well, Virginia, there are >3 ns ?
